International Trade Commission: Investigation of Laptops, Routers, and Gateways
The International Trade Commission has instituted an investigation into alleged infringement related to certain laptops, routers, gateways, and their components. This notice formally begins the investigation process under Section 337 of the Tariff Act of 1930.

International Trade Commission Investigation: Electric Unicycles
The International Trade Commission has instituted an investigation into certain gyro-stabilized electric unicycles, components, and products containing them. This action, designated Investigation No. 337-TA-1488, will examine potential violations of U.S. trade laws related to these products.

International Trade Commission - Disposable ENDS Investigation
The International Trade Commission has instituted an investigation into certain disposable and other closed-system electronic nicotine delivery systems (ENDS) devices and components thereof. This notice initiates the investigation, identified as Investigation No. 337-TA-1486, under Section 337 of the Tariff Act of 1930.
International Trade Commission - Violation of Section 337
The International Trade Commission has issued a final determination finding a violation of Section 337 concerning certain cameras, camera systems, and accessories. Remedial orders have been issued, and the investigation has been terminated.
Certain Freight Rail Couplers from India: Preliminary Countervailing Duty Determination
The International Trade Administration has issued a preliminary affirmative countervailing duty determination concerning certain freight rail couplers and parts thereof from India. This notice aligns the final determination with the final antidumping duty determination.

Steel Wire Rod Duty Orders Continuation from Brazil, Indonesia, Mexico
The International Trade Administration has issued a notice regarding the continuation of antidumping and countervailing duty orders on steel wire rod from Brazil, Indonesia, Mexico, Moldova, and Trinidad and Tobago. This action confirms the ongoing application of these duties.
